When it comes to ancient civilizations, the topic of sexuality is often shrouded in mystery. However, the ancient Egyptians were quite open about their sexual practices and beliefs, allowing us an unprecedented glimpse into their world. From their views on love and marriage to the use of contraceptives and even phallic worship, ancient Egyptian sexuality offers a fascinating exploration of a society that lived over three thousand years ago.

In ancient Egypt, sexual desire and pleasure were regarded as natural and integral parts of human life. Contrary to some other ancient cultures, which perceived sexual activity as solely for procreation, the ancient Egyptians embraced the idea of sex for pleasure and enjoyment. They believed that sexual relations played a crucial role in maintaining cosmic order and fertility. As such, they did not shy away from sexuality or consider it taboo.

Marriage was highly valued in ancient Egypt, and it was expected for individuals to marry and start a family. Married couples were often depicted in Egyptian art, emphasizing the idea of a harmonious and loving relationship. Interestingly, women held significant power in the realm of marriage and divorce. Unlike in many other societies, ancient Egyptian women had the right to divorce their husbands and initiate separations.

Contraception was also a topic of interest to the ancient Egyptians. Records indicate that they used various methods to prevent pregnancies, such as inserting crocodile dung or a mixture of honey and sodium carbonate into the vagina for spermicidal effect. Ancient Egyptian papyrus scrolls even document the use of plant-based contraceptive substances, suggesting that they had a deep understanding of herbal medicine. These early forms of contraception reflect the importance the ancient Egyptians placed on family planning.

One of the more intriguing aspects of ancient Egyptian sexuality is the presence of phallic worship. The symbol of the erect phallus, known as the “khnum,” played a significant role in their religious practices. It symbolized fertility, regeneration, and protection against evil forces. Phallic amulets were commonly worn by both men and women to ensure a prosperous and fertile life. The phallus was also featured prominently in temple art and reliefs, serving as a reminder of the importance of sexuality in both the divine and human realms.
